This might help you :) 👉 12 Week Flutter Training from Newbie to Expert: heyflutter.com Source Code: github.com/JohannesMilke/firebase_auth_verify_email
@HarutakaShimizu2 ай бұрын
yeahhhh great video!! Thanks, and I like your calm voice
@DavidBLo1002 жыл бұрын
Great job!!!! Quick, precise, clear, and backed up with clean codes!!!! You are the BEST.
@aryanbhasein643110 ай бұрын
Wonderful video!
@HeyFlutter10 ай бұрын
Thank you, @aryanbhasein6431! 🙂
@ArtVandelayInc4 ай бұрын
Works like a charm! Thank you for the tutorial
@HeyFlutter4 ай бұрын
Glad to hear that, You are most welcome @ArtVandelayInc
@Patrickus232 жыл бұрын
Great tutorial! I have a question: If a user press the cancel button to not verify mail anymore, the mail and password information will still be displayed in the Firebase Database?
@__mothership__84752 жыл бұрын
1. Reset FIrebase email 2. Phone OTP verification using firebase 3. FCM for iOS Please make these tutorials
@karemzky3 жыл бұрын
Thanks for the video , kindly can you make a Video on phone authentication and verification
@atoli14253 жыл бұрын
just the thing I was waiting for, well done.
@oyebayooluwafemi65152 жыл бұрын
Great Video I have 2 questions. First, is it possible to verify with a code instead of a link. Secondly, can i verify the email address first before inputting user data like the password, username, phone number.
@oyebayooluwafemi65152 жыл бұрын
@@HeyFlutter The app I'm currently developing, upon registration the user have to verify the email (an OTP code should be sent to the email address of the user) before being logged into the app. Using the method on flutter documentation, it only sends a link to the user not an OTP code. So I'm asking if it's possible to send an OTP code instead of a link. The second question is I want the user to input only the email first, then after verifying the email he can them input other information like username, age, gender, fullname and password to complete the registration. Cause all the implementation I'm seeing online you must input both email and password for email verification. Another questions please, how to do reset password from the app. I want to be able to reset the password on the app. Thank you
@muhammadafzal2372 жыл бұрын
Please make video on "how to post http request from flutter to any api" or "how to post data from flutter app to any api".
@cavidanbagiri78372 жыл бұрын
as always. You are number one. Thanks teacher for all of tutorials.
@Yelllow_Flash3 жыл бұрын
I'm on watch for these tutorial series. Awesome Work.
@ShahNawaz-mo7ki Жыл бұрын
I have done it successfully by following you tutorial thank u so much
@HeyFlutter Жыл бұрын
Glad to hear that, You are most welcome @ShahNawaz-mo7ki! 😊
@KnowledgeWorld-LetsLearn3 жыл бұрын
Thanks a lot for this video.. Was waiting for it
@jaredweinfurtner99763 жыл бұрын
great tutorials and love the editing - perfect cadence.
@edilsonroque66917 ай бұрын
THEEEE BEST, Thank you my friend
@HeyFlutter7 ай бұрын
You are welcome, @edilsonroque6691 😊
@fatemaabdulrahman32902 жыл бұрын
Quick and straight to the point. Thanks!
@HeyFlutter2 жыл бұрын
You are welcome, Fatema Abdulrahman!
@zihenghuang5980 Жыл бұрын
Thanks for the video! I was wondering what I should do if I want to add the user information to firestore after email verification? Is it possible? Thanks
@HeyFlutter Жыл бұрын
Hey 😊, @zihenghuang5980! Check out this video: kzbin.info/www/bejne/e6OzkKuloq1-itk This will surely help you
@yeryer3162 жыл бұрын
Joannes, this works fine for me on the googles, although when sending out to a university email address the link is expiring due to it taking long time to arrive. Do you know which bit of code is causing this?
@HeyFlutter2 жыл бұрын
Thank You Ramsey Merdassi! Follow this link: stackoverflow.com/questions/73107783/firebaseauthexception-firebase-auth-user-token-expired-the-users-credential I hope you will get your answer 🙂
@swayamshreemohantyvlogs81263 жыл бұрын
I will going to use this in app my application. Thanks Mike
@geekybrick81893 жыл бұрын
Thank you, this is very helpful! Could you please make a video on running a firebase app in offline mode? I.e., handling dropped connection, caching, delayed submission of data to the cloud firestore (e.g., when the user connects to the internet again), etc. your work is greatly appreciated!
@HimanshuAtri-b7l11 ай бұрын
if we have 2 different page for sign in and log in (one for creating the account and the other for logging in, which most of the app does) then in order to avoid user logging in without verifying email we need to delete the user account as soon as he clicks cancel. even in that case there is chance user could close page by back button instead using cancel option so on login page we also need to add a check is email verified or not.
@HeyFlutter10 ай бұрын
Thanks for the suggestion, @user-sc5qo7sq1n! 🙂
@princemuleya76962 жыл бұрын
hey how can i implement email-already-in-use in flutter firebase
@HeyFlutter2 жыл бұрын
Thank You Prince Muleya! Follow this link: stackoverflow.com/questions/51652134/check-if-an-email-already-exists-in-firebase-auth-in-flutter-app I hope you will get your answer 🙂
@princemuleya76962 жыл бұрын
Thank you very much sir It helped
@khabibali49677 ай бұрын
@@HeyFlutter That's what I am looking for.
@nuwandissanayake9008 Жыл бұрын
Great tutorial, well explained. All in one... Thank you for the best...
@HeyFlutter Жыл бұрын
You’re most welcome, Nuwan Dissanayake! 🙂
@shahanshaeek83222 ай бұрын
Can i customize the email subject like “your code sent “ ??? Any option ???
@HeyFlutter8 күн бұрын
Thank you ❤️ for the suggestion! We’ll definitely consider it for our future content ideas. 😊
@uDubRiceBoy Жыл бұрын
Hi HeyFlutter, in 2023, is it still worth it to have an email signup/signin option or just force users to use a "standard" auth provider, google signin, apple, facebook ...?
@HeyFlutter Жыл бұрын
Thank you, uDubRiceBoy! 🙂. People still use it in their apps.
@MillionviewsYT13 жыл бұрын
keep it up bro nice job
@hecroesmodejesus70162 жыл бұрын
on your github, when i try to request a get a blank page, thanks for the video.
@asadullah45883 жыл бұрын
Sir How to access your github. I already send many request's as you mentioned in your Readme but not getting any email please help me? Love from Pakistan
@asadullah45883 жыл бұрын
@@HeyFlutter sir I didn't get any email for confirmation of subscription.
@saravanaprasadk82382 жыл бұрын
i need an help at pressing login button check the email is verified or not? if it is not verified i need to show a toast message if it is verified i need to go home page
@__mothership__84752 жыл бұрын
Firebase phone otp verification for iOS ?? any tutorial available ?
@JanardhanRay2 жыл бұрын
hello sir, can you help me by creating this for web app which has basic html and javascript? 🙏🙏🙏🙏🙏 thanks in advance
@JanardhanRay2 жыл бұрын
Sir I am saying only if you change the programing Language from dart to JavaScript.
@ajielesmana16022 жыл бұрын
what if I'm using realtime database, not cloud firestore, is this code work for it?
@HackAWays2 жыл бұрын
Great , How about phone number otp with firebase?
@HeyFlutter2 жыл бұрын
Thanks for the idea, Aye Zarni Aung! 🙂 I have added it to my list of ideas for future videos!
@jessenjie62022 жыл бұрын
can this be combined with google, facebook and twitter sign in?
@HeyFlutter2 жыл бұрын
Thank You Jessen Jie! Follow this link: medium.com/codechai/firebase-twitter-sign-in-and-flutter-13799f0183ad I hope you will get your answer 🙂
@jessenjie62022 жыл бұрын
@@HeyFlutter Thankss
@TareqAlothman2 жыл бұрын
Hello Johannes, thanks for another great tutorial. Unfortunately, this method will not work as FirebaseUser.emailVerified status does not get updated after clicking the link from the verification email. I am testing this on the emulator, but I am clicking on the link from the email from the browser, which is not on the emulator. The User data does not get refreshed / updated with verification status even after calling User.reload(). This is again, if the email client is on another device than the app. If you have encountered this problem and know a fix please advise. Thank you again for all your awesome tutorials.
@HeyFlutter2 жыл бұрын
Hello, Tareq Alothman! Follow this link: stackoverflow.com/questions/59854615/firebase-flutter-reload-not-refreshing-user-isemailverified, I hope it will solve your problem. Thank You 🙂
@KrityukIIITV Жыл бұрын
ya you are totally right, i also need its proper solution :(
@mugdadelneama7389 Жыл бұрын
It's not moving to verify email automatically I should do hot restart , what's the solution ?
@HeyFlutter Жыл бұрын
Thank You @mugdadelneama7389! Follow this link: firebase.google.com/docs/auth/flutter/email-link-auth I hope you will get your answer 🙂
@syedzeerakhussaingillani6019 Жыл бұрын
Thanks alot, for making this so easy
@HeyFlutter Жыл бұрын
Glad it was helpful, @syedzeerakhussaingillani6019 😀
@skyorizen2 жыл бұрын
what is formKey ? can you please make it clearer ?
@HeyFlutter2 жыл бұрын
Hey 😊, @cakrawirajaya445! Check out this article: www.javatpoint.com/flutter-form
@GuardianLinks3 жыл бұрын
Hello,please make a video how add in friend peoples as Facebook
@GarenBisZumTod2 жыл бұрын
Is there a way that the user is not created until you accept the verification E-Mail? Or is he automaticly always created with the createEmailWithPassword method from firebase
@HeyFlutter2 жыл бұрын
Thank You garen. exeee! Follow this link: stackoverflow.com/questions/68364731/firebase-do-not-create-users-until-email-is-verified I hope you will get your answer 🙂
@RahulKambad0072 жыл бұрын
Great Tutorial, It helped me a lot 😀
@yunusemreyildirim2338 Жыл бұрын
Thank you very very much
@HeyFlutter Жыл бұрын
You’re most welcome, Yunus Emre YILDIRIM! 🙂
@yeryer3162 жыл бұрын
I want to send the verification email when they click the SignUp button with a snackbar message telling the user that they've been sent an email. I want to avoid the VerifyEmail screen. I'd like the user to go to the Homepage once they've clicked on the verify link in the email. Is this possible?
@HeyFlutter2 жыл бұрын
Thank You Ramsey Merdassi! Follow this link: firebase.flutter.dev/docs/auth/usage/ I hope you will get your answer 🙂
@seyrow75923 жыл бұрын
Hey I have the following problem that this whole Flutter App story does not want to start on the Android emulator it always comes the following error code: "The command "App" is either spelled incorrectly or could not be found. Error: Main class org.gradle.wrapper.GradleWrapperMain could not be found or loaded. Cause: java.lang.ClassNotFoundException: org.gradle.wrapper.GradleWrapperMain Exception: Gradle task assembleDebug failed with exit code 1" could someone please help me? :c
@sumitsharma68962 жыл бұрын
I am not getting any emails and giving me this error Ignoring header X-Firebase-Locale because its value was null.
@HeyFlutter2 жыл бұрын
Hello, Sumit Sharma! Follow this link: stackoverflow.com/questions/64727665/w-system-ignoring-header-x-firebase-locale-because-its-value-was-null, I hope it will solve your problem. Thank You 🙂
@MoRmdn2 жыл бұрын
Thank you, for your excellent work but I have a problem verifying emails send to the user's spam folder
@HeyFlutter2 жыл бұрын
Hello, Mohamed Ramadan! Follow this link: stackoverflow.com/questions/46283859/firebase-email-verification-goes-to-spam-folder, I hope it will solve your problem. Thank You 🙂
@sabeehaisrar8385 Жыл бұрын
Please make videos on AR CORE in flutter
@HeyFlutter Жыл бұрын
Thanks for the idea, Sabeeha Israr! 🙂 I have added it to my list of ideas for future videos!
@maiahenriquevitor2 жыл бұрын
Thank you!!! You're amazing!
@HeyFlutter2 жыл бұрын
You’re most welcome, Vitor Henrique! 🙂
@kikalamuofficial58653 жыл бұрын
How do you do it with the Bloc Pattern?
@soorajks55682 жыл бұрын
I got an error "Ignoring header X-Firebase-Locale because its value was null" what is the reason
@HeyFlutter2 жыл бұрын
Thank You Sooraj K S! Follow this link: stackoverflow.com/questions/64727665/w-system-ignoring-header-x-firebase-locale-because-its-value-was-null I hope you will get your answer 🙂
@soorajks55682 жыл бұрын
@@HeyFlutter Thank you for the reply
@thompsonlaw12 жыл бұрын
very helpful
@yx4 Жыл бұрын
Hi HeyFlutter, thanks for this video, but I saw an error before that the firebase send an alert on the emulator that they blocked this device because of too many requests, I think this problem happen because of the timer.periodic function. How can I solve this problem? Does it happen on the production phase only or what? Thanks.
@HeyFlutter Жыл бұрын
Thank You @yx4! Follow this link: stackoverflow.com/questions/37601942/firebase-3-we-have-blocked-all-requests-from-this-device-due-to-unusual-activi I hope you will get your answer 🙂
@yx4 Жыл бұрын
@@HeyFlutter Thanks
@ricard4583 жыл бұрын
Will you teach how to do phone number verification?
@ricard4582 жыл бұрын
@@HeyFlutter thanks. If some day you create a vídeo about this, I will also watch it.
@flutterquick Жыл бұрын
how to email verification without firebase pls i need it
@HeyFlutter Жыл бұрын
Hey 😊, @amanuelgulilat2733! Check out this solution: stackoverflow.com/a/68157123
@dapollo13 жыл бұрын
Phone authentication please
@gxg33682 жыл бұрын
Thx
@HeyFlutter2 жыл бұрын
You are welcome, GxG 😊
@joseinTokyo2 жыл бұрын
niceeee
@HeyFlutter2 жыл бұрын
Thanks, Jose Oriol Lopez! 🙂
@prabinojha91222 жыл бұрын
Why do you make people have to subscribe to your newsletter to get access to your source code. Can you please make it viewable without this I don't want to subscribe to what you are forcing me to subscribe to. Total scam.
@HeyFlutter2 жыл бұрын
Thank You Prabin Ojha!. I showed the main functionality, which is important for this package. Learn more about it here: github.com/JohannesMilke/sponsorware
@safaksenal46563 жыл бұрын
your videos are very good. I have a request from you, can you follow and unfollow the user?
@abdullaharrezwan6712 жыл бұрын
Utils.showSnackBar(e.toString()); why Utils is used here? thanks in advanced.
@HeyFlutter2 жыл бұрын
Thank you, Abdullah Ar Rezwan! 🙂. I used it to show snackbar.
@ahmedgames9335 Жыл бұрын
nice work , but when i check in rules if the account is verified or not i can not access despite of i was verified the email ? match /users-auth/{uid}/notes/{note_doc} { allow read, write: if request.auth != null && request.auth.uid == uid && request.auth.token.email_verified; }
@HeyFlutter Жыл бұрын
Thank You Aĥmêd Gâmeŝ! Follow this link: stackoverflow.com/questions/59860832/how-to-update-data-for-firebaseuser-stream-when-email-is-verified-flutter/67044680#67044680 I hope you will get your answer 🙂
@ricard4583 жыл бұрын
How can we customize the email layout?
@pablosaas2 жыл бұрын
See the firebase web console > Authentication > Templates > Edit template